What to Look for When Monitoring Network Performance and Security Metrics
Categories :
A reliable and secure network is crucial for businesses and organizations of all sizes. Network performance and security directly impact productivity, user experience, and the overall security posture of your systems. As a result, monitoring network performance and security metrics has become an essential task for IT teams.
Whether you're an IT professional or a business owner, understanding what to look for when monitoring these metrics can help you maintain optimal performance and prevent costly breaches or downtime. In this guide, we’ll explore the key factors to consider when monitoring network performance and security metrics, ensuring your network remains both efficient and secure.
Why Monitoring Network Performance Matters
The importance of monitoring network performance and security metrics cannot be overstated. Network performance monitoring ensures that data and communications flow seamlessly, enabling users to work without disruptions. Poor network performance, such as slow speeds, dropped connections, or high latency, can lead to inefficiencies, frustrating users, and diminishing productivity. In contrast, network security monitoring helps to detect and mitigate potential threats before they compromise your network’s integrity.
By proactively monitoring these metrics, businesses can identify problems early, respond to incidents faster, and ensure that critical infrastructure remains protected from cyber threats. Furthermore, maintaining visibility into network performance allows for more effective resource management, helping to optimize network usage and reduce costs.
Network Bandwidth and Throughput
One of the most important metrics for network performance is bandwidth—the maximum rate at which data can be transferred over your network. Monitoring bandwidth usage is crucial because excessive bandwidth consumption can lead to network congestion, slowdowns, and decreased productivity. By tracking this metric, you can identify areas of high demand and ensure that your network is operating at peak efficiency.
Throughput, on the other hand, measures the actual data transfer rate, which is often lower than the available bandwidth due to factors like network congestion, packet loss, and latency. Comparing throughput to bandwidth helps you assess how well the network is performing in real time. Monitoring both metrics enables you to make informed decisions about capacity planning, upgrades, or adjustments to alleviate bottlenecks and improve overall performance.
Firewall and Intrusion Detection Systems (IDS)
Network security is another critical aspect of monitoring. A key component of network security is the firewall, which acts as the first line of defense by blocking unauthorized access and filtering incoming and outgoing traffic. For example, Fortinet Saicom Managed Services can help enhance this process by providing advanced firewall management, ensuring that logs and security alerts are continuously monitored for potential threats. It also ensures that the firewall is configured correctly to prevent breaches.
Intrusion Detection Systems (IDS) and Intrusion Prevention Systems (IPS) also play a vital role in detecting and responding to malicious activity on your network. IDS systems monitor network traffic for suspicious behavior and generate alerts when potential threats are identified. On the other hand, IPS systems take proactive steps to prevent threats by blocking malicious traffic in real-time. By continuously monitoring the data generated by these systems, you can identify unauthorized access attempts, malware infections, and other forms of attack.
Latency and Packet Loss
Latency refers to the time it takes for a data packet to travel from the source to the destination and is measured in milliseconds (ms). Low latency is essential for applications that require real-time communication, such as video conferencing, online gaming, or VoIP. High latency can cause delays, dropped calls, and a poor user experience, which can be especially disruptive in business environments.
Packet loss occurs when data packets fail to reach their destination, which can happen due to network congestion, faulty hardware, or transmission errors. This metric can severely impact network performance, causing applications to freeze, videos to buffer, or files to fail during transfer. Monitoring latency and packet loss together allows you to identify network issues that affect the user experience and quickly address them before they escalate into larger problems.
Network Availability and Uptime
Network availability refers to the percentage of time the network is operational and accessible. A network that experiences frequent downtime can lead to lost productivity, frustrated users, and potential revenue loss. Monitoring uptime is critical to ensuring that your network remains available when it’s needed most. By regularly assessing network availability, you can track performance trends, detect anomalies, and ensure that service level agreements (SLAs) are being met.
Tools like ping tests, SNMP (Simple Network Management Protocol), and syslog monitoring are often used to track network availability and uptime. These tools provide real-time feedback on whether your network is operating as expected or if downtime has occurred, helping you respond promptly to minimize disruptions.
Traffic Flow and Application Performance
The performance of individual applications running on your network is another crucial metric to monitor. Applications such as email, CRM systems, or enterprise resource planning (ERP) software rely heavily on network performance to function efficiently. By monitoring traffic flow, you can determine which applications are using the most bandwidth and how well they are performing.
Network flow monitoring tools like NetFlow or sFlow are particularly useful for identifying which applications are consuming the most resources. These tools can also highlight any unusual traffic patterns, helping you spot potential performance issues or malicious activity. Application performance monitoring (APM) tools, in combination with network flow data, provide insights into how well your applications are interacting with the network, ensuring they are optimized for performance and reliability.
Security Metrics
Beyond firewalls and IDS/IPS, network security metrics also include the detection of malware, vulnerabilities, and other security threats. Malware detection involves monitoring your network for any signs of viruses, ransomware, spyware, or other malicious software that could compromise your data or systems. Tools such as antivirus software, endpoint detection and response (EDR) systems, and network-based malware scanners can help identify and mitigate malware threats.
Vulnerability scanning is another critical aspect of security monitoring. Regularly scanning your network for vulnerabilities—such as unpatched software, misconfigurations, or weak access controls—can help you identify potential weaknesses before attackers can exploit them. Automated vulnerability scanners are widely used to detect these issues and generate reports to guide remediation efforts.
Threat detection involves continuously analyzing network traffic for indicators of compromise (IoC) or patterns of malicious activity. Tools such as Security Information and Event Management (SIEM) systems aggregate logs and alerts from various sources, helping you correlate and analyze data to identify potential security threats. By monitoring these security metrics, you can proactively respond to emerging threats and minimize the risk of data breaches or attacks.